Procurement Category Manager - Nick Richardson

Summary of Matter or Issue Requiring Decision:

Decision to extend the contract for CPQ1183-15 – Forms Ordering Service, which was awarded under Lot 1 of the CP814-12 Print Framework.

Decision Taken:

To extend the contract (Subject to due diligence) with the below organization(s) for the provision of the above contract.  The contract extension will commence on 1st February 2017 for the period of 12 Months, with an option to extend for a further 12 months

 

Astra Printing Group

1 Willand Road, Cullompton, Devon EX15 1AP

Summary of Reason(s) for Decision Taken:

The decision has been taken on the basis that this is the most appropriate option at this stage following an options appraisal

Summary of Alternatives or Options considered and rejected:

An options appraisal was completed and the following options considered:

  • Extend the current contract for 12 months
  • Award a new contract under the framework

Do nothing and let the contract expire

Details of any conflict of interest and dispensation granted to the Officer taking the decision or by any Member of the Council in delegating responsibility for any specific express delegation:

No conflict of interest
